For 15 years, Clothes Mentor has been a staple in the Lee’s Summit community, offering high-end fashion at a fraction of retail prices. But under the fresh leadership of a passionate, marketing-savvy owner, the beloved resale boutique fuses fashion-forward thinking with a fierce commitment to sustainability.

A seasoned marketer with a background in e-commerce, owner Rachel Dicke, saw more than just a successful resale store. She saw an opportunity to elevate the experience for women who crave quality, style, and a sense of purpose in shopping. “I wanted to create a shopping destination where women could discover the latest styles from the best brands, all while making a positive impact through sustainable fashion choices,” she says.

At the heart of Clothes Mentor’s mission is a dedication to reducing textile waste through resale. “Our entire business model is rooted in sustainability,” she explains. “By giving pre-loved clothing a second life, we’re extending the fashion lifecycle and reducing demand for new production.”

According to the Environmental Protection Agency, the average American throws away about 81 pounds of clothing annually. According to CALPIRG, there’s already enough clothing on Earth to clothe the next six generations. “That’s insane,” she says. “Especially because most of it is still wearable. Every item we resell is one less garment contributing to that growing environmental issue.”

Clothes Mentor isn’t just about selling used clothes, it’s about making secondhand shopping feel luxurious and empowering.

Shoppers stepping into the Lee’s Summit store are greeted by a clean, beautifully merchandised space with boutique energy and a highly curated inventory of trendy, seasonal styles.

“Our prices are about 70% less than traditional retail, but our quality and customer service are unmatched,” she says.

Women can sell gently used items directly to the store and choose cash or store credit, many choosing the latter to restock their wardrobe with “new to them” fashion. This cyclical model is more than just smart; it’s sustainable.

“MORE SHOPPERS ARE BECOMING CONSCIOUS CONSUMERS,” SAYS RACHEL. “THEY WANT TO REDUCE WASTE AND INVEST IN QUALITY OVER QUANTITY. THE STIGMA AROUND SECONDHAND SHOPPING IS FADING— IT’S NOW SEEN AS SAVVY AND STYLISH.”

In a world where fast fashion dominates, Clothes Mentor is helping change the narrative. “More shoppers are becoming conscious consumers,” she says. “They want to reduce waste and invest in quality over quantity. The stigma around secondhand shopping is fading—it’s now seen as savvy and stylish.”

And the community is taking notice. Word of mouth has been a powerful tool, with new customers walking in daily after hearing rave reviews from friends or seeing social media posts. “People walk in and say, ‘Wow, this store is so clean and organized!’ and ‘These prices are phenomenal!’ That’s our favorite part—surprising people with the quality of our inventory.”

Beyond the storefront, the team partners with local influencers, women’s groups, and sustainability organizations to raise awareness. Overflow product is donated to women’s nonprofits like Hope House and Mother’s Refuge, extending their mission beyond fashion.

Looking to the future, Clothes Mentor has big plans. The store’s 15th anniversary in May will bring month-long celebrations, promotions, and events that highlight its impact on the community. This summer, they’re launching a personal shopper program, pairing customers with local stylists who’ll curate selections based on personal style profiles, further enhancing the boutique feel of the resale experience.

The store has also embraced the digital age with a robust e-commerce platform (leessummitmo. clothesmentor.com), allowing women nationwide to shop their curated selection. Shoppers can choose local pickup and try items in-store before purchasing, bridging the gap between online convenience and in-person confidence.

Authenticity and quality are never compromised. Each item is hand-inspected for brand, condition, and style, and luxury items are authenticated with precision. With styles for women aged 25 to 95, the inventory reflects a wide range of sizes and aesthetics, designed to flatter every body at every stage of life.

The store’s owner is especially proud of how her marketing background shapes the store’s vision. “We’re building something special here. It’s not just about clothes—it’s about confidence, community, and conscious choices. I truly believe resale is the future, even if the product comes from the past.”

Her passion and precision are driving results. With strategic goals and a clear long-term vision, Clothes Mentor is poised to be more than just a local shop— it’s a movement.

And if she could leave Lee’s Summit women with one message?

“Fashion should be both beautiful and responsible. By choosing resale, you’re making a powerful impact on your wardrobe, your wallet, and the planet. Small changes in the way we shop can lead to a more sustainable future for everyone.”

In Lee’s Summit, that future is already taking shape, one stylish, secondhand piece at a time.

From Stem To Vase:

TRANSFORMING FLORALS INTO ART

Flowers have a rich history of symbolic meanings.

As far back as the 19th century, they were used to convey secret messages. Stories throughout history recount how flowers were used to send hidden messages between people. French publishers began producing flower dictionaries that cataloged the many floral codes that had been gathered over time. Some of these meanings were linked to the flower’s root name, often derived from mythology, while others were drawn from the flowers themselves. The colors, medicinal properties, and even the superstitions

associated with these flowers all contributed to the creation of this secret language.

In addition to their symbolic significance, flowers bring natural beauty to any interior, enhancing spaces with their color, texture, and mood-boosting qualities. Floral arrangements not only create a cozy atmosphere but also infuse a room with personality, elevating the overall ambiance. There are multiple ways to creatively integrate florals into your home, and whether using fresh or artificial flowers, creative displays can make quite the statement piece.

Florals and Fruit

“Not only will the flowers’ fragrance fill the air, but the citrus notes from the fruit will add a refreshing scent.”

Add an extra burst of color and texture to your floral arrangement by layering fruit around the edges of your vase. To achieve this, place a smaller vase inside a larger one, ensuring the flowers stay contained in the inner vase to preserve their shape. Fill the surrounding space with water and then arrange sliced fruit along the vase’s outer sides. For a fresh touch, add ice cubes to keep the fruit looking vibrant longer and to hold them in place. Not only will the flowers’ fragrance fill the air, but the citrus notes from the fruit will add a refreshing scent.

Flower Frogs

Using a frog to display flowers creates a minimalist yet elegant look that highlights the individuality of each bloom. It helps the stems stay in place. To set it up, place the frog on your chosen display base, whether it’s a vase, bowl, platter, or any container you prefer. Then, simply insert the flower stems by gently pressing them into the prongs. Tip: Flowers with sturdy stems and a lighter top work best in a frog, as delicate blooms tend to lose their shape more quickly.

“Tip: Flowers with sturdy stems and a lighter top work best in a frog, as delicate blooms tend to lose their shape more quickly.”

Hanging Florals

For a dramatic effect, try creating a hanging floral display. Floral cones are available for this style, or you can craft your own for a more personalized, organic look. The contrast between long-stemmed white flowers and a dark wall creates a striking visual impact.

No matter how you choose to display them, flowers are a wonderful addition to any room. They boost mood, improve air quality, spark creativity, and bring a decorative charm to any space.

ARTICLE BY ALLISON SWAN | PHOTOGRAPHY BY JANIE JONES

Jill Underwood’s journey in the mortgage industry began long before she ever imagined owning her own company.

“I started in the early 1980’s when I was very young. My mother was a realtor, and as a teenager, she taught me about equity, negotiations, and helping people with their home purchases. I quickly fell in love with the mortgage industry, and I have been on the front lines helping people ever since.”

Decades of experience led Jill to a pivotal moment in her career—one that pushed her to take control of her future.

“Starting my own business was a long time coming! Frankly, I was in a place in my career where I needed a change. I was frustrated. So, I gained great clarity on exactly what I want the remaining years of my career to look like, and then I marched forward and created my vision.”

Jill founded her brokerage business to deliver an unparalleled, personalized mortgage experience tailored to each client’s unique needs.

“The decision to become a mortgage broker was easy. The broker side of my industry allows me to be aligned with dozens of lenders so I have more products to offer, so I can help more people. The mortgage broker world helps consumers save thousands of dollars in fees and creates the opportunity to seek the best loan product to meet each individual consumer’s needs.”

Her brand identity wasn’t something she sought out—it found her.

“A handful of years ago, a friend told me I should call myself the Mortgage Queen. At first, I thought it was cheesy, but the name stuck with me. Some days I loved it; other days, not so much. It kept coming back to me, and eventually, I decided to embrace it. My business mentor gave me my first assignment: name my company. Since I had already built the Mortgage Queen identity, continuing with it was the natural next step, and that’s how Your Mortgage Queen LLC came to life.”

“My job is to educate my clients, walk them through the process, and show them their options. The prize and the best days are when I see my clients’ joy at their closing celebration!”

Jill’s four decades in the mortgage industry give her an undeniable edge that allows her to see the bigger picture.

“I have seen so many changes in my industry. I’ve seen the good times and the bad times. I can recall when and why certain guidelines were created, and I share those stories with my clients and realtors.”

Expertise alone isn’t enough—she also brings deep empathy to every transaction.

“I remember buying my first home. I was scared and completely lost—it was emotional! First-time homebuyers feel that same anxiety, and I’ll never forget that.”

She also understands that homeownership isn’t just about buying a house, but also about navigating life’s transitions.

“I’m not afraid to take on a challenging loan. I know how to help self-employed clients because I can read tax returns and calculate income the way an underwriter would.”

Beyond the numbers, she connects with her clients on a personal level.

“I’ve been divorced and I know what it feels like to be a single woman raising a teenager with no help. I know what it feels like to sell the marital home of 19 years and figure out how to start all over again. I know what it’s like to get older and downsize and move into a smaller home. With all the years of my experience, I have been in darn near every category

of homeowner, every life cycle, so I can relate to the emotions and issues my clients face. That’s what I love about how I help people. It’s important to understand what they are going through and to give them comfort and hope.”

That’s why Jill does what she does—to make the process easier, to offer hope, and to celebrate each client’s success.

“My job is to educate my clients, walk them through the process, and show them their options. The prize and the best days are when I see my clients’ joy at their closing celebration!”

If Jill could give one piece of advice, it would be this: "Google doesn’t know everything, and social media is not the place to get advice.  Great advice comes from an experienced loan officer who has your best interest in mind. Ask your close friends and family for a referral to a mortgage expert. Ask your financial advisor or CPA for a referral to a great loan officer. Social media is like the old yellow pages—when you get a referral to someone, use the internet to determine if you think you will like that person. Talk to them, or better yet, go meet them in person.”

With unmatched industry knowledge, a passion for helping people, and a deep understanding of the emotions tied to homeownership, Jill Underwood truly lives up to her name. Your Mortgage Queen is located at 410 SE 3rd Street in Lees Summit. For more information, visit yourmortgagequeen.net

For Jen Macias-Wetzel, owner of Inspired Closets KC, providing organized, functional  spaces for her clients is just one part of her mission. She is equally dedicated to creating an  environment where she and her employees can grow, learn and thrive.

Jen’s commitment to personal development stems from her own journey.

Growing up in a blue-collar family, the norm was to enter the workforce immediately after  high school. “College wasn't something that was in the cards for me at the time,” Jen  explains. “The expectation was to get a job, start earning a living.” And that's exactly what  she did. She built a successful career in marketing and business development, primarily in  the architectural and multi-family development sectors, all while raising three sons.

But education stayed implanted in the back of her mind. “It has always been a source of  angst, wishful thinking,” she says. After years of balancing work and family life, she decided  to go back to school. This May, after nearly 29 years, that long-held dream will become a  reality when she graduates with a degree in business administration and marketing.

Jen’s experience has inspired a deep commitment to making higher education accessible  for future generations of her family. “I want my future grandchildren to have the  opportunities I didn’t have. I want to make sure they have the resources to pursue their  dreams,” Jen says.

Living by the motto, “To walk a mile, you have to take a first step,” Jen has already set her  next personal challenge. “I’m half Mexican, but I don’t speak Spanish. I want to learn to be  fluent and honor that heritage.”

Jen’s passion for growth is deeply imbedded in the culture she is building at Inspired  Closets KC. “Seeing my team succeed is one of the most rewarding parts of my job,” she  says. “From our office manager to our designers to our installation team, they are always  learning, always improving. I love when they come to me with new ideas. It means we’ve  created an environment where they feel comfortable sharing and innovating.”

One of the team’s newest members is designer Alexis Cross, who serves the Lee’s Summit  area for Inspired Closets KC. Under Jen’s mentorship, Alexis has joined the Lee’s Summit  Chamber of Commerce and is learning the importance of networking and professional  development. “She’s incredibly driven,” Jen shares.

“Her energy, tenacity and creativity are  inspiring, and she brings such a positive presence to our team.”

Alexis says that Jen has laid the foundation for her to be successful. “It all starts with  dedicated client interfacing and being part of a team. Jen is a strong leader who will  support us every step of the way. She encourages us to build the business independently,  all while providing the resources for growth.”

“Working for Jen and Inspired Closets KC is everything I have ever wanted and more. It has  opened my eyes to the idea of unlimited possibilities,” Alexis proudly states.

The entire team has taken to prioritizing community involvement, under Jen’s tutelage. In  April, the women of Inspired Closets KC joined

forces with Habitat for Humanity to help  build a house. Jen sees it as “an important opportunity—it’s good for business, it’s good for  your personal self and it’s good for the employees’ morale.” Alexis understands that each  new experience is helping her build her confidence and cultivating a deeper commitment  to community outreach. She says, “I am just starting to dip my toes in the water, but I am  learning how impactful it can be talking to people and being involved.”

Jen is focused on fostering a workplace where employees feel valued and empowered. She  says, “I want to be the kind of boss I always wish I had. A leader who supports and  encourages their team, who provides opportunities for learning and development. Growth  is magical, and I want to share that magic with my team.”

Jen Macias-Wetzel is building more than a business—she is establishing a culture of  growth, mentorship, and community engagement. Her journey serves as an inspiration,  proving that it’s never too late to pursue a dream or take the first step toward something  new. Through Inspired Closets KC, she is not only creating organized spaces but also  opportunities for those around her to grow, thrive, and give back.

Beyond the Headlines: Understanding Measles and How to Keep Your Child Safe

If you read our recent measles alert, you know that cases are on the rise again, particularly in the Midwest. For many parents, that news sparks worry and questions: Why is this happening? Is my child at risk? What can I do to keep my family safe?

At Community Choice Pediatrics, we believe informed parents are empowered parents. In this companion article, we go beyond the headlines to give you a deeper understanding of measles, why it’s making a comeback, and how we work with you to prevent its spread.

Why Are Measles Cases Coming Back?

Although measles was officially declared eliminated in the U.S. in 2000, we’ve seen a recent increase in outbreaks. Why? A few key factors are at play:

• Lower vaccination rates in certain communities have made it easier for the virus to spread

• International travel increases exposure to measles in regions where the virus is still common

• Misinformation about vaccines has caused some families to delay or skip immunizations

Measles is one of the most contagious viruses in the world—up to 90% of unvaccinated people who are exposed will become infected. It only takes one case to spark a community outbreak, which is why prevention matters now more than ever.

Who’s Most at Risk?

While measles can affect anyone who isn’t protected, some people face greater risk for complications, including:

• Infants under 12 months, who are too young for the MMR vaccine

• Pregnant women, who face a higher risk of miscarriage or premature birth if infected

• People with weakened immune systems, such as those undergoing cancer treatment

Even if your child is vaccinated, staying informed and proactive helps protect others in our community who cannot be.

What To Do

If You Think Your Child Has Been Exposed

If you hear of a local case or suspect your child has been exposed, here’s what to do:

1. Call our office before coming in – We can help assess the situation and take precautions to keep other patients safe.

2. Monitor symptoms carefully – Early signs include fever, cough, runny nose, and red, watery eyes.

3. Watch for a rash – A red, blotchy rash typically appears a few days after initial symptoms, starting on the face and spreading downward.

Don’t panic, just call. Our team is here to walk you through what steps to take and answer any questions along the way.

Why Vaccination Still Matters

The MMR vaccine is safe, effective, and our best defense against measles. The CDC recommends:

• First dose at 12–15 months

• Second dose at 4–6 years

Two doses provide approximately 97% protection. Vaccinating your child also protects those who are most vulnerable, helping to stop outbreaks before they start.

Still have questions? Talk to your provider. We’re happy to review your child’s vaccination records and provide science-backed answers to any concerns you may have.
